Monitoring computers is an essential task for any IT professional or system administrator. It allows you to keep track of the health and performance of your computers, identify potential problems, and ensure that your systems are running smoothly.
There are a number of different ways to monitor computers, but the most common and effective method is to use a monitoring tool. These tools can be either hardware-based or software-based, and they can provide you with a wealth of information about your computers, including:
CPU usage
Memory usage
Disk usage
Network traffic
Process status
Event logs
By monitoring this information, you can identify potential problems early on and take steps to prevent them from causing major disruptions. For example, if you see that your CPU usage is constantly high, you may need to upgrade your hardware or optimize your software. Or, if you see that your network traffic is unusually high, you may need to investigate for security breaches or unauthorized access.
There are a number of different monitoring tools available, both free and paid. Some of the most popular tools include:
Nagios
Zabbix
Splunk
Syslog
SolarWinds Server & Application Monitor
The best monitoring tool for you will depend on your specific needs and budget. However, all of the tools listed above can provide you with the information you need to keep your computers running smoothly.
In addition to using a monitoring tool, there are a number of other things you can do to monitor your computers. These include:
Check the event logs: The event logs can provide you with a history of all the events that have occurred on your computer, including errors, warnings, and informational messages. You can use the event logs to troubleshoot problems and identify potential security threats.
Use performance counters: Performance counters are a set of metrics that can be used to measure the performance of your computer. You can use performance counters to identify bottlenecks and optimize your system.
Monitor the network: Monitoring the network can help you identify network problems and ensure that your computers are communicating properly.
